[0001] This utility model relates to the field of medical and nursing device technology, and in particular to a nursing bed accessory connection mechanism and a nursing bed. Background Technology
[0002] Nursing beds are used for patient treatment and rehabilitation. During treatment, patients need to receive intravenous infusions, undergo examinations, be upright for meals, and turn over. To meet these needs, nursing beds can be fitted with accessories such as IV stands, dining board supports, and detachable guardrails. These accessories are typically installed on the bed frame. Currently, nursing bed frames have pre-drilled holes for connecting accessories. For example, there are pre-drilled holes for attaching IV stands to the frame edges, or pre-drilled mounting structures for inserting accessories like guardrails. However, the connection mechanisms for accessories on existing nursing beds are relatively fixed in location, and the types of accessories they can accommodate are limited. This makes it difficult to add any type of accessory according to the patient's needs. Some accessories can only be fixed to the ground outside the nursing bed using external brackets, making the use of the nursing bed and accessories inconvenient. Utility Model Content

[0004] The nursing bed accessory connection mechanism according to the first aspect of the present invention includes:
[0005] The first connector has a first snap-fit portion at the top and a first connecting portion at the bottom;
[0006] The second connector is arranged opposite to the first connector on the left and right. The top of the second connector is provided with a second snap-fit part, and the bottom of the second connector is provided with a second connecting part. The second snap-fit part is detachably snap-fitted with the first snap-fit part. The second connector and the first connector form a connecting groove that runs through the front and back. The connecting groove is used to hold the bed frame of the nursing bed. The first connector and / or the second connector are provided with a connecting structure. The connecting structure is used to connect accessories.
[0007] The third connector connects the first connector and the second connector.
[0008] The nursing bed accessory connection mechanism according to the present utility model has at least the following beneficial effects: After selecting a first connector or a second connector with a corresponding connection structure according to the type of accessory, the first connector and the second connector are respectively set on the left and right sides of the nursing bed frame. The first connector and the second connector are moved to a suitable installation position for the accessory, which facilitates the use of the accessory. Then, the first snap-fit part at the top of the first connector is snapped into the second snap-fit part at the top of the second connector, so that the first snap-fit part and the second snap-fit part are snapped into the top of the bed frame. Then, the first connecting part at the bottom of the first connector and the second connecting part at the bottom of the second connector are connected by a third connector, so that the connecting groove formed by the first connector and the second connector clamps the nursing bed frame, ensuring that the accessory is firmly fixed. Therefore, by adopting the nursing bed accessory connection mechanism, the first connector and the second connector with a corresponding connection structure can be selected according to the type of accessory, so that any accessory can be added to the nursing bed, and the installation position can be adjusted at will according to the usage requirements of the accessory, which greatly improves the convenience of using the nursing bed and the accessory.

[0039] Reference Figures 1 to 3 As shown, in the first embodiment, the nursing bed accessory connection mechanism includes a first connector 100, a second connector 200, and a third connector 300.
[0040] The middle part of the first connector 100 is recessed to the left to form a connecting groove 101. The connecting groove 101 is rectangular and runs through the front and rear direction. The top of the first connector 100 is provided with a first snap-fit portion 110 extending to the right, and the bottom of the first connector 100 is provided with a first connecting portion 120 extending downward.
[0041] Reference Figure 2 As shown, the first snap-fit part 110 is provided with a snap-fit groove 111. The snap-fit groove 111 is provided with a limiting groove 1111 and a clearance groove 1112 arranged from left to right. The width of the clearance groove 1112 in the front-back direction is smaller than the width of the limiting groove 1111 in the front-back direction, so that the snap-fit groove 111 is a T-shaped groove with the left side larger than the right side. Both the limiting groove 1111 and the clearance groove 1112 penetrate downward through the first snap-fit part 110, so that the limiting groove 1111 and the clearance groove 1112 are connected to the connecting groove 101.
[0042] The first connecting part 120 is provided with a screw hole 500 that runs through in the left and right direction.
[0043] A connecting structure 130 is provided on the left side of the first connector 100, and the connecting structure 130 is located to the left of the connecting groove 101. The connecting structure 130 is a slide rail 131, which extends vertically. A baffle 132 is provided at the bottom of the slide rail 131 to limit the downward sliding stroke of the accessory and limit the height of the accessory. The slide rail 131 can be used to install accessories with grooves, such as railings with vertical grooves, infusion poles with vertical grooves, or dining boards with vertical grooves, etc.
[0044] The top of the second connector 200 is provided with a second snap-fit portion 210 extending to the left, and the bottom of the second connector 200 is provided with a second connecting portion 220 extending downward.
[0045] Reference Figure 2As shown, the second latching part 210 is provided with a latching block 211. The latching block 211 is provided with a limiting block 2111 and a connecting block 2112 connected from left to right. The width of the connecting block 2112 in the front-back direction is less than the width of the limiting block 2111 in the front-back direction. The shape of the limiting block 2111 and the connecting block 2112 matches the shape of the limiting groove 1111 and the clearance groove 1112, so that the latching block 211 is a T-shaped block with the left side larger than the right side. The thickness of the limiting block 2111 and the connecting block 2112 in the vertical direction is the same as the depth of the limiting groove 1111 and the clearance groove 1112 in the vertical direction.
[0046] The first connector 100 and the second connector 200 are arranged opposite each other in the left and right direction. The limiting block 2111 and the connecting block 2112 of the locking block 211 are respectively inserted into the limiting groove 1111 and the clearance groove 1112 of the limiting groove 111, so that the top surface of the second locking part 210 is flush with the top surface of the first locking part 110, so as to prevent items on the nursing bed from pushing the top protruding first locking part 110 or the second locking part 210 out of the bed.
[0047] The second connecting part 220 is provided with a through hole 400, which extends through the second connecting part 220 in the left-right direction. The through hole 400 is directly opposite the screw hole 500. The third connecting member 300 includes a screw 310 and a knob 320. The knob 320 is installed on the head of the screw 310. The screw 310 passes through the through hole 400 from right to left and is screwed into the screw hole 500. The left side wall of the knob 320 abuts against the right side wall of the second connecting part 220, and the screw 310 is screwed into the screw hole 500 to lock the second connecting part 220 and the first connecting part 120.
[0048] Reference Figure 3 As shown, in use, the connecting groove 101 of the first connector 100 is aligned with the left side of the nursing bed frame 10, and the left side of the bed frame 10 is the side of the nursing bed facing outward. That is, the connecting groove 101 of the first connector 100 is fitted onto the bed frame 10 from the left side of the nursing bed toward the bed frame 10. Then, the second connector 200 is moved downward from above the bed frame 10 so that the locking block 211 of the second locking part 210 is inserted into the locking groove 111 of the first locking part 110. It is not necessary to make any transverse adjustments on the inner side of the bed frame 10. The installation saves installation space for the second connector 200. Then, the screw 310 of the third connector 300 is screwed into the screw hole 500 from right to left through the through hole 400. The left side wall of the knob 320 abuts against the right side wall of the second connecting part 220, and the screw 310 is screwed into the screw hole 500 to lock the second connecting part 220 and the first connecting part 120, so that the bed frame 10 is clamped in the connecting groove 101, and the accessories can be inserted into the slide rail 131 of the connecting structure 130 on the left side of the first connector 100.
[0049] When disassembly is required, first remove the accessory from the connecting structure 130 on the left side of the first connector 100. Then, use the knob 320 to unscrew the screw 310 out of the screw hole 500 and disengage it from the through hole 400 to separate the third connector 300. Next, move the second connector 200 upward to disengage the second locking part 210 from the first locking part 110 of the first connector 100, so that the second connector 200 is disengaged from the top of the bed frame 10. Finally, disengage the first connector 100 to the left side of the bed frame 10, that is, disengage the first connector 100 from the outside of the bed frame 10.
[0050] Reference Figures 4 to 6 As shown, in the second embodiment, the structures of the first connector 100, the second connector 200, and the third connector 300 are the same as those in the first embodiment. The difference lies in that the connecting structure 130 on the left side of the first connector 100 is a cannula 133, and the cannula 133 is provided with a through hole 134 extending vertically. The through hole 134 of the cannula 133 can be used to install accessories with insert rods, such as railings with vertical insert rods, infusion poles with vertical insert rods, or dining boards with vertical insert rods, etc.
[0051] Reference Figures 7 to 9 As shown, in the third embodiment, the structures of the first connector 100, the second connector 200, and the third connector 300 are substantially the same as those in the first embodiment.
[0052] The difference lies in the following characteristics.
[0053] Reference Figure 8 As shown, the first connecting part 120 is provided with a through hole 400 extending in the left and right direction, the second connecting part 220 is provided with a screw hole 500 extending in the left and right direction, and the screw 310 of the third connecting member 300 passes through the through hole 400 of the first connecting part 120 from left to right and is screwed into the screw hole 500 of the second connecting part 220.
[0054] Reference Figure 9 As shown, the connecting structure 130 on the left side of the first connector 100 is a crossbeam 135 extending in the front-back direction. Two nursing bed accessory connecting mechanisms are connected to the left and right sides of the crossbeam 135 respectively. The front and rear ends of the crossbeam 135 are respectively provided with mounting holes 136 that run through in the vertical direction. The crossbeam 135 can be used to install accessories with connecting rods, such as railings with vertical connecting rods, infusion rods with vertical connecting rods, dining boards with vertical connecting rods, or headboards or footboards with vertical connecting rods, etc.
